Last Harvest and Winter Prep


Pulled the honey supers today and extracted four more frames. Deep, rich goldenrod honey and very sweet. I started feeding the thick, fall syrup, too. The first batch contains fumidil b to ward of nosema, and two tablespoons of HoneyBee Healthy. I really need to get on top of the varroa mite infestation. I noticed a few dozen dead and dying bees outside the hive with deformed wing virus which is caused by mites. I also witnessed the poor, stupid drones being evicted from the hive.
